Cape Coral Garden Club seeks vendors for March in the Park
Preparations are under way for the 9th annual “March in the Park”, a plant and garden art sale, to be held on Saturday March 11, 2017, from 9 am to 3 pm, at Jaycee Park in Cape Coral. The Garden Club of Cape Coral is once again looking for plant vendors and crafters of garden related items.
“March in the Park” is the major fundraising event for the Garden Club of Cape Coral. All proceeds from “March in the Park” help the Garden Club achieve their goals of awarding local high school students merit awards in horticulture, civic beautification, Habitat for Humanity, Wekiva Youth Camp sponsorships, and to promote civic awareness of environmental and conservation concerns.
Last year the Garden Club had over 30 vendors in attendance selling all kinds of plants, from ground cover to palm trees, and garden art, from stepping stones to fish faces. Master gardeners will be available to answer questions. Every hour there will be informative speakers. Children’s creative projects will be found at the kids Booth, along with a face painter. Opportunity drawings, food and music will be available thru out the day. This year plans are under way for an even bigger event.
